How to fill out contractor license application

Illustration

How to fill out Contractor License Application

01
Obtain the Contractor License Application form from the appropriate regulatory agency.
02
Fill in your personal information, including your name, address, and contact information.
03
Provide details about your business, including the business name, address, and type of business structure (e.g., sole proprietorship, LLC).
04
List your relevant work experience, including past jobs and any specialized training.
05
Select the appropriate contractor classification(s) that pertain to your work.
06
Include any required documentation, such as proof of insurance and bonding, certificates, or licenses from previous work.
07
Pay the application fee, as specified by the regulatory agency.
08
Review your application for completeness and accuracy before submission.
09
Submit your application to the regulatory agency, either online or by mail, as required.

Getting your Ohio electrical contractor license You will need to fill out this application, pay a $25 application fee, hold $500,000 in liability insurance, and pass two exams: a trade exam and a business/law exam. You must score at least 70% on both exams to receive your license.

How to get a contractor's license in Cleveland, Ohio Completed and notarized application. Provide proof of bond coverage of at least $25,000. Power-of-Attorney Form attached to the bond. Certificate of insurance naming the City of Cleveland as “additional insured” and “certificate holder.” Insurance endorsement.

To get an Ohio contractor license from the state, you need to: Submit your application and pay the processing fee. Complete a background check – This must be completed before sitting the exam. Pass your trade exam. Show proof of insurance – Tradespeople need at least $500,000 in general liability insurance coverage.

A Contractor License Application is a formal request submitted to a state or local regulatory authority to obtain a license that legally permits an individual or business to perform contracting work.
Individuals or businesses engaged in construction, renovations, electrical work, plumbing, or other contracting activities are typically required to file a Contractor License Application.
To fill out a Contractor License Application, applicants must provide their personal and business information, details about their qualifications and experience, and any required documents such as proof of insurance and background checks, following the specific instructions provided by the licensing authority.
The purpose of a Contractor License Application is to ensure that contractors meet specified standards of competency, financial responsibility, and legal compliance to protect consumers and maintain quality in the construction industry.
Typically, the information required includes the applicant's name, business name, address, contact information, work history, references, details about the type of contracting work to be performed, proof of liability insurance, and any necessary licenses or certifications.
